System Updates

In addition to app updates, your Firestick may require system updates to ensure that it is running smoothly. System updates can fix bugs, improve performance, and add new features. Failing to update your Firestick can result in issues with apps such as Dish Anywhere.

Workaround

To check for system updates, go to Settings > My Fire TV > About > Check for Updates. If an update is available, select “Install Update” to download and install the latest version. You can also enable automatic updates by going to Settings > My Fire TV > About > Install System Updates Automatically.

Troubleshooting Guide for Dish Anywhere App on Firestick

Step 1: Check Your Internet Connection

The first step in troubleshooting the Dish Anywhere app on your Firestick is to check your internet connection. Make sure that your Firestick is connected to a stable Wi-Fi network. If your internet connection is slow or unstable, it can cause issues with streaming apps like Dish Anywhere. Try resetting your router or modem, and move your Firestick closer to your Wi-Fi router if possible.

Step 2: Restart the Dish Anywhere App

If the issue persists, try restarting the Dish Anywhere app. You can do this by pressing the Home button on your Firestick remote, then navigating to the Dish Anywhere app and pressing the Menu button. Select Quit and then reopen the app to see if it works properly.

Step 3: Clear the Cache and Data

If restarting the app doesn't help, try clearing the cache and data for the Dish Anywhere app. To do this, go to Settings on your Firestick home screen, then select Applications. Find the Dish Anywhere app and select Clear cache and Clear data. This should reset the app and may fix any issues you're experiencing.

Step 4: Uninstall and Reinstall the App

If none of the previous steps help, you can try uninstalling and reinstalling the Dish Anywhere app. To do this, go to Settings on your Firestick home screen, then select Applications. Find the Dish Anywhere app and select Uninstall. Once the app is uninstalled, go back to the Amazon Appstore and reinstall it. This should give you a fresh version of the app that may work properly.
